grub4dos啟動CentOS 6.8安裝 - 儲存設備

Table of Contents

這裡就不贅述grub4dos要怎麼安裝,預設已經裝好grub4dos
只說明如何使centos 6安裝程式正常運作
1.複製CentOS 6 iso file到ext2/ext3分割區根目錄(暫定/dev/sda2)
2.抽取iso內的/isolinux, /images複製到硬碟(隨身碟)前80G的分割區內(暫定(hd0,0))
且放/images的分割區必須是ext2/ext3(ext4沒試過)
/isolinux可以隨便放,放在NTFS內也沒問題

要是你會重build kernel也知道DVD boot的kernel source
你可以重build kernel與initrd來支援ext4/ntfs,省掉額外一個分割區的麻煩
3.編寫menu.lst
LANG=zh_TW.UTF-8: 指定安裝時語言使用繁體中文,未指定預設是en_us.utf-8
以下範例將/isolinux放在(hd0,0)
/images與ISO檔放在(hd0,2)

title CentOS 6.8 i386 iso
root (hd0,0)
kernel /CentOS/CentOS-6.8-i386/isolinux/vmlinuz linux LANG=zh_TW.UTF-8
initrd /CentOS/CentOS-6.8-i386/isolinux/initrd.img
savedefault --wait=2

4.開機進入後會詢問install.img的位置
請指向到/dev/sda2(hd0,2),安裝程式會自動加上預設路徑/images/install.img

5.如果ISO file放在step 1的位置,你應該會自動載入ISO並進行安裝
若是放其他路徑,安裝程式會詢問你
若是放在非ext2/ext3的分割區內,安裝程式無法mount,因此也無法使用

有問題請回信箱,有空的話盡量幫各位解答

--

All Comments

Ethan avatarEthan2016-10-04
須要grub安裝win嗎?最近剛裝了一個。
Christine avatarChristine2016-10-08
如果想用grub4dos裝win,有個好用的工具tut43
http://www.rmprepusb.com/tutorials/firawiniso
使用這個套路可以直接使用ISO開機
Liam avatarLiam2016-10-09
但必須使用grub4dos 0.46a修改版才能載入ISO